Mrs Mel Jell is an elderly woman with diabetes who has been too sick to get out of bed for a couple of days. She has had a severe cough and has been unable to drink during this time. She is admitted to hospital and you note some of her lab results are: – Sodium (Na+) 156 mEq/L – Potassium (K+) 4 mEq/L – Chloride (Cl-) 115 mEq/L It has been determined that Mrs Jell has a hypertonic imbalance with a high solute extracellular fluid (ECF) concentration. Qu1a) What has happened for a condition where “high solute extracellular fluid (ECF) concentration” has occurred in Mrs Jell’s case? Qu1b) What electrolyte imbalance do you think Mrs Jell is exhibiting signs of? Qu1c) List at least four (4) symptoms that you might expect Mrs Jell to be displaying? MINI-CASE STUDY 2 Your patient Mr Norm Yawn has been feeling unwell of recent. He has been feeling weak, bloated and now is constipated, not having opened his bowels for a couple of days. His potassium level is 3.2 mEq/L. Qu2a) What is Mr Yawn suffering from. In your answer, discuss the pathophysiology linking these symptoms to his condition ? Qu2b) What treatment is likely to be considered for Mr Yawn?
